# lilt-en-funsd

This model is a fine-tuned version of [SCUT-DLVCLab/lilt-roberta-en-base](https://huggingface.co/SCUT-DLVCLab/lilt-roberta-en-base) on the funsd-layoutlmv3 dataset.
It achieves the following results on the evaluation set:
- Loss: 1.4801
- Answer: {'precision': 0.8607888631090487, 'recall': 0.9082007343941249, 'f1': 0.8838594401429422, 'number': 817}
- Header: {'precision': 0.6404494382022472, 'recall': 0.4789915966386555, 'f1': 0.548076923076923, 'number': 119}
- Question: {'precision': 0.8991899189918992, 'recall': 0.9275766016713092, 'f1': 0.9131627056672761, 'number': 1077}
- Overall Precision: 0.8720
- Overall Recall: 0.8932
- Overall F1: 0.8825
- Overall Accuracy: 0.8040

## Training procedure

### Training hyperparameters

The following hyperparameters were used during training:
- learning_rate: 5e-05
- train_batch_size: 2
- eval_batch_size: 2
- seed: 42
- optimizer: Adam with betas=(0.9,0.999) and epsilon=1e-08
- lr_scheduler_type: linear
- training_steps: 2500
- mixed_precision_training: Native AMP
